Deep Sequencing Services

Image of NovaSeq instrumentDSCL instruments include the Illumina NovaSeq 6000, MiSeq, and MiSeqDx.
MiSeq flowcells have a single lane, and their paired-end runs can be customized with asymmetric reads. These have a minimum read length of 25bp, and a maximum that depends on the chemistry version. Contact the Core for more info.
Single or Dual Multiplexing is available on all platforms (see section below).

Indexing
horizontal divider

Indexed/multiplexed/barcoded libraries can be mixed and run together if you do not need the maximum amount of depth available. "Illumina-style" indexes are located between the P7 or P5 linker and associated adapter, and require a separate read. "Inline barcodes", on the other hand, are read as part of your insert (not an index read), and require base-balancing.
For very high-throughput instruments like the NovaSeq, dual 8bp indexing or better is strongly recommended. See the Sample Submission and Resources pages for more details about library structure.
The Core will demultiplex your libraries after the run provided that you send a list of sample names and indexes.
